Output 43d0042d6dc29ce0fc53685d419aed8d40b6bb477fab29cf641659af4752ca5d:1

value
89320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a0ccb564e8ee6a874a2cc112d4b2310fee4cb08 OP_EQUAL
address
36yxSddtbheLcw2nD2KvXPfEE4oRm11z1S
transaction
43d0042d6dc29ce0fc53685d419aed8d40b6bb477fab29cf641659af4752ca5d
confirmations
508480
spent
true